Buying Guide

Key purchase considerations

When selecting soccer training tools, consider your primary goals: speed and agility, ball control, or overall athletic conditioning. Durability matters for frequent use, especially outdoors. If you train solo, look for gear that returns balls or provides independent practice options, such as solo trainers or rebound boards. Space and portability are crucial for home gyms and field setups; compact sets with a carrying bag are valuable. Finally, think about your age and level—youth players benefit from adjustable equipment that grows with them, while adults often need more durable, higher-resistance options.

Training goals and product focus

For speed, acceleration, and footwork, prioritize ladder systems, hurdles, and adjustable parachutes that add resistance. To improve ball handling and passing accuracy, choose rebound boards and solo trainers that offer realistic ball feedback and repeatable drills. Cones are foundational for marking drills, dribbling patterns, and tactical layouts. A well-rounded training kit often combines all of these elements, enabling comprehensive practice sessions without constant equipment changes.

Space is a key constraint: field access, gym floors, or backyards each require different equipment footprints. All-weather durability matters for outdoor sessions, while portability matters for traveling teams. Safety considerations include stable bases for ladders and poles, proper supervision for younger players, and proper footwear to prevent slips on artificial turf or concrete. For beginners, start with foundational sets (cones and ladder) and gradually add advanced tools (parachutes, rebound boards) as skills grow. This staged approach supports progressive training without overloading athletes.
